What is the legal status of abortion in Canada and do we need a law? Experts weigh in

Summary by Ground News
Abortion has been legal in Canada since 1988, when the Supreme Court decided a law that criminalized abortion was unconstitutional. No government has since attempted to legislate on the issue. Abortion falls under provincial health-care systems as a medical procedure, meaning that access to the procedure varies considerably from place to place.
